Kumano Kodo: beginner's trail

  • 4 days
  • Osaka

This tour gives you access to one of the most sacred areas of ancient Japan. It was here, in these deep and misty mountains that the syncretic religious practices that make this country so distinctive from the rest of Asia, were founded. You will climb the mountains by ancient staircases with stone or wooden steps on which the emperors of old times used to perform their devotions. 

This tour gives you access to one of the most sacred areas of ancient Japan. It was here, in these deep and misty mountains that the syncretic religious practices that make this country so distinctive from the rest of Asia, were founded. 

You will climb the mountains by ancient staircases with stone or wooden steps on which the emperors of old times used to perform their devotions. You'll cross torrents and pass through impressive forests of cryptomeria, cypress and majestic camphor trees. 

After your exertions, you will be able to relax in the thermal springs along the way, and sleep in the inimitable comfort of charming little Japanese inns. Finally, you will admire two of the most famous shrines of the Shinto religion listed as World Heritage Sites, in their natural settings.

Your excursion in detail

Itinerary

  • Day 1 : To the South of Kii Peninsula

    The train departs from Osaka Central Station, which is easily reached from Kyoto or Shin-Osaka (TGV). 

    The train departs at around midday for the South of Kii peninsula and the province of Wakayama, where the track runs alongside the Inland Sea. 

    You will arrive at a small station by the sea, which you will leave by bus to reach the starting point of the walk 40 minutes later. 

    On this first day, a short walk of around 2 hours will allow your body to adapt to the very special terrain of the Japanese mountains and arrive early at your first stop, a small village on a plateau with an unobstructed view. 

    The hot baths, healthy local food and tranquil views will prepare you ideally for the first day's walking the following day.

  • Day 2 : The great sanctuary

    You'll have a hearty breakfast before walking to a bus stop. This 30-minute drive will take you to the heart of the pilgrimage route. 

    You'll then make your way along the path under the canopy of the great cryptomerias, which will occasionally open up to give you a glimpse, through a gap, of a line of wooded mountains, a plateau with rice paddies and charming little villages as you pass through. 

    After around 4 hours' walking, you'll reach the great sanctuary of Kumano Hongû Taisha, with its sumptuous wooden buildings embellished with gold. 

    You can then enjoy the beauty of the entire site at your leisure before continuing on to Yunomine, Japan's oldest spa where pilgrims purified themselves. This magical place is where you'll find your accommodation, and where you can once again sample the delights of Japanese hospitality.

  • Day 3 : The sublime waterfall

    After breakfast, , a short bus ride will take you to a small town, from where the trail continues through the forest. 

    Today's stage, lasting around 5 hours, has a lower altitude through a landscape of cedars that is now familiar. Small stone statues and beautiful views will brighten up this short hike, during which you won't come across many people. 

    Then, in the afternoon, you'll return to the wider valleys, with their languid rivers and a few hamlets on their banks. Here, in the heart of the mountains, you can recharge your batteries in a charming country inn.

  • Day 4 : Inside the mountains

    This is the last stage, and our muscles are now ready to climb the highest point of the route, the Echizen pass, in the morning. 

    There is no road that will take us closer to our goal on this section. We have to cross the mountain for 6 sublime hours of steep, mysterious landscapes. 

    The rewards are well worth the day's efforts, with the sight of the great red pagoda of Nachi Taisha in the green setting of a mountain cirque ! 

    Nearby is the great waterfall, the highest in Japan, cascading uninterrupted from the lush vegetation to a pool 130 metres below ! An unforgettable sight.

    The jagged coastline is not far away now, and you'll reach it by a short bus ride before taking the train back to civilisation.
